FIRE IN COLLEGE ST.
A fire occurred this morning at the residence of Mr J. Middlebrook, senr., College Street. The ringing of the fire bell bad the effect of bringing out a large number of people, who quickly proceeded to the scene of the conflagration, ready and eager to assist in any way possible to get the fire under which by this time had a good hold of the building. The fire evidently originated in the kitchen, but the exact cause has not yet been ascertained. Considerable damage was done to the interior, but thanks to a plentiful supply of water, the progress of the fire was checked and a large part of the building was saved, together with the furniture.
